Rishikesh, often referred to as the Yoga Capital of the World, is a sacred town nestled in the foothills of the Himalayas, along the banks of the holy River Ganga. Surrounded by serene mountains and lush forests, it is a place where spiritual seekers, adventure enthusiasts, and travelers come together. From practicing Yoga and meditation in peaceful ashrams, such as the famous Beatles Ashram, to exploring ancient temples and attending soulful Ganga Aarti ceremonies, Rishikesh offers a unique blend of spirituality and culture. At the same time, it is a hub for thrilling water sports, such as white-water rafting, making it a destination where inner peace and adventure blend seamlessly.

Passport / Visa
Visa requirements vary depending on your nationality and are the traveler’s responsibility. Please check your country’s requirements. Applications for visas can be submitted at the Indian consulate or embassy, or through the services of a travel agent or visa processing agency. You must have a valid passport for at least six months after your arrival date to be permitted entry into India.
